SGPT is bit elevated but less than 2 times normal SGOT and and ALP are normal.are you symptomatic with high uric acid? Like ankle and toe pain with redness etc.?
Next Steps
increase water consumption avoid  alcohol drinks repeat uric acid after 2 months,if still high consider medications
